Land-Divers of Melanesia

Documentary To ensure a good yam crop, men of Pentecost Island in Melanesia attach vines to their ankles and dive headlong from a wooden tower over 100 feet tall. Those who dive say the fall clears their mind. The vines are relatively elastic and the ground is softened so injury is rare.
